Do not take this the wrong way Sir but if Parcells can make a recommendation you should drop that stupid skid recovery assist ASAP. We’ll let you drive with it as long as you like (or until you start dive bombing into every corner wink) that’s for sure but you’re doing yourself no favors by leaving it on. Initially (like the first couple of races last night when it was forced off) you will lose control of the car more frequently and it can be a tad frustrating but in the long run you will definitely have better car control.

 

Each car has its own “limit” as to how far you can push it before you lose traction and this assist takes that “limit” and pushes it further into the unrealistic range which gives you a false sense of security as to what the cars actual “limit” really is. Use it if you wish and/or consider turning it off and adding some traction control maybe it don’t matter much as long as we have some close battles.

Skid recovery is without a doubt the biggest assist in GT5 which is kind of why we decided as group long ago to force it off and over time those of us that did use it got used to having it off. As such I always force it off when setting up the room but whenever you want it on just say so or simply change the setting yourself (host has no more control over the room than any participant)…it may take more than one week for you settle in without it???

 

From time to time we do run super-powerful cars where one or more of us would like to use it so we turn it on, no big deal.
